Smith-Blair Inc – Emissions Trend

Texarkana, AR · 2019–2023 · Parent: Xylem Inc

This page assembles 5 consecutive years of EPA Toxics Release Inventory Form R filings for Smith-Blair Inc, spanning 2019–2023. Each annual total aggregates on-site air emissions, surface-water discharges, land disposal, and off-site transfers reported by the facility under EPCRA Section 313, which requires disclosure whenever a listed chemical is manufactured, processed, or otherwise used above threshold quantities.

Reported releases opened at 49 in 2019 and closed at 145.2K in 2023 – a increase of 298245.3% over the window. The chart below stacks the four TRI release media (air, water, land, off-site) and overlays the yearly total. The top contributor by cumulative mass is Nickel And Nickel Compounds at 122.4K, followed by Manganese And Manganese Compounds at 23.6K.

Because TRI figures are estimated, not metered, year-over-year deltas can reflect methodology revisions, ownership changes, or shifts in what a facility classifies as reportable, not only physical emission changes. Treat the trajectory as a disclosure record, and cross-reference with the EPA Enforcement and Compliance History Online (ECHO) system for the fuller regulatory picture on this fabricated metals facility.

Year-over-Year Comparison

Year Total Chemicals YoY Change
2019 49 lbs 3 -
2020 62 lbs 3 +28.3%
2021 765 lbs 3 +1125.0%
2022 520 lbs 3 -32.0%
2023 145.2K lbs 3 +27824.2%

Top Chemicals by Year

Chemical 20192020202120222023 Total
Nickel And Nickel Compounds 12 16 255 255 121.9K 122.4K
Manganese And Manganese Compounds 18 25 255 255 23.1K 23.6K
Chromium and Chromium Compounds(except for chromite ore mined in the Transvaal Region) 18 22 255 10 250 555

About This Data

Trend data is sourced from the EPA Toxic Release Inventory (TRI). Facilities report annually. Release quantities are self-reported estimates. Year-over-year changes may reflect changes in production, pollution control measures, reporting methodology, or chemical thresholds.

A decrease in reported releases does not necessarily indicate improved environmental performance, as it may reflect production cutbacks, facility closures, or changes in reporting requirements. Similarly, increases may reflect expanded production rather than degraded environmental practices.
